Output fe907870ee4b64acd0fe6777c46df62c28c66984c3e5ae5e776ca60dfe6865b4:92

value
85660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fba52231fbac3e36df3719a472b70a968dbc4d OP_EQUAL
address
38541PGw2BP3a3V57EaSXZS72g3PWYGhSV
transaction
fe907870ee4b64acd0fe6777c46df62c28c66984c3e5ae5e776ca60dfe6865b4
spent
true